首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

获取表的id并作为外键插入到其他列中

,可以通过数据库的自增主键来实现。在关系型数据库中,每个表都会有一个自增的主键字段,通常命名为id。当插入一条新的记录时,数据库会自动为该记录生成一个唯一的id值。

要获取表的id,可以使用数据库的查询语句,例如在MySQL中可以使用以下语句获取表的id:

代码语言:txt
复制
SELECT id FROM 表名;

然后,将获取到的id作为外键插入到其他列中,可以通过插入语句来实现。假设有一个表A和表B,表B中有一个外键列A_id,需要将表A的id作为外键插入到表B中的A_id列中,可以使用以下语句:

代码语言:txt
复制
INSERT INTO 表B (A_id, 其他列名) VALUES (SELECT id FROM 表A, 其他值);

这样就可以将表A的id作为外键插入到表B中的A_id列中。

关于数据库的更多知识,可以参考腾讯云的云数据库产品,例如腾讯云的云数据库MySQL,它是一种高性能、可扩展的关系型数据库服务,适用于各种规模的应用场景。

腾讯云云数据库MySQL产品介绍链接:https://cloud.tencent.com/product/cdb_mysql

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的合辑

领券